Thousands of Free Toothpaste Tubes Given Away in Victoria

28 May 2026 | News

Over the past few weeks, the Australian Dental Foundation has been busy distributing thousands of free toothpaste tubes across Australia as part of its ongoing Brush for Good campaign.

A major highlight of the campaign took place across Victoria, where more than 4,400 tubes of toothpaste were given away at Preston Market, Sunshine Marketplace and Dandenong Market. The events attracted strong community interest, with 1,452 tubes distributed at Preston Market, 1,364 at Sunshine Marketplace, and an impressive 1,628 at Dandenong Market. The Dandenong giveaway proved especially popular, with all toothpaste distributed in just 45 minutes.

The Brush for Good campaign focuses on supporting communities with affordable dental essentials, helping Aussies maintain healthy habits.

So far, the initiative has already given out over 10,000 free toothpaste tubes across Australia, with the next booth popping up at Adelaide Railway Station on 29 May.
